Gents,

I've been working hospital night shifts for the past month, which limits BoB moderating time (to say nothing of my pipe smoking time!)

I have another stint of that coming soon, but as I have a little free time, I'm going to catch up on my old moderator duty of sorting posts into appropriate topics.

This is just a friendly reminder of an existing practice, but there's a lot of new blood (which is great) so hopefully this will cut down on confusion.

So, if you're looking in the Round Table and a post seems to have gone walkabout, it was probably just moved to a more specific area--music posts to music, sports to sports, Pipe and Tobacco posts to their respective homes, etc.

As always, you can use the View Your Posts link at the top right of the main page to find topics you've posted in.
